New Zealand’s coronavirus vaccine rollout has begun – SBS News
New Zealand expects its nationwide rollout will take a full year.

New Zealand has started its official rollout of Pfizer-BioNTechs COVID-19 vaccine.
A small group of medical professionals were injected on Friday in Auckland ahead of the wider rollout which was officially starting with border staff and so-called Managed Isolation and Quarantine workers on Saturday, officials said.
Today, we kick off the largest immunisation programme in our history, by vaccinating the first of our border workforce, a critical step in protecting everyone in Aotearoa, New Zealand…
